New 7-seat Renault SUV to mainly compete with a corporate cousin from Nissan set to follow shortly after, as well as the Hyundai Alcazar, Tata Safari, and Mahindra XUV 7XO

While on one hand Renault is preparing for the sales start of the all-new Duster in India, on the other, it is already working on a second major launch. The next model will be a 7-seat version of the all-new Duster, possibly with a new name and subtle design changes.

The upcoming 7-seat Renault SUV derived from the all-new Duster was spied on test recently. The three-row model is likely to have a longer body measuring about 4.55 metres in length and a slightly longer wheelbase of around 2.70 metres.

The exterior of the new 7-seat Renault SUV would have a familiar, authentic SUV stance with an upright front fascia, prominent skid plates, a high ground clearance, pronounced wheel arches, and strong shoulder lines. The rear windscreen would be less raked compared to the Duster, freeing more room for luggage in the boot.

Inside, the 7-seat Renault SUV should feature a layout similar to the all-new Duster, but with a different design and colour scheme. Higher-quality plastics, more soft-touch materials, and additional comfort features, including sliding and reclining second-row seats, are also expected. The second-row seats will likely come with a one-touch fold and tumble mechanism to make ingress in the third row easier. The boot could include a dedicated button to conveniently fold the third row seats and free up more luggage space.

A 10.25-inch digital instrument cluster, a 10.1-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a wireless smartphone charger, a 64-colour ambient lighting system, an electronic parking brake, a dual-zone automatic climate control system, ventilated front seats, and a panoramic sunroof will likely be among the features shared with the all-new Duster. The panoramic sunroof should be slightly bigger, though. On the safety front, expect Level 2 advanced driver assistance systems, a 360º camera system, and six airbags.

Renault will likely launch the 7-seat SUV with a 1.3-litre turbocharged four-cylinder petrol engine that develops 158 hp and 280 Nm of torque and a choice of 6-speed manual and 6-speed dual-clutch automatic transmissions in Q4 2026. The company will likely introduce a hybrid system based on a 1.8-litre naturally aspirated engine producing 158 hp and 172 Nm of torque by mid-2027.
